Handover Note — Franchise Agreement, Marrowfield Territory

From outgoing Director of Partnerships to incoming Director.

The Bristlecone Kitchens franchise agreement enters its renewal window in March. Royalty terms were renegotiated last year; the finance team holds the current fee schedule and audit rights summary. Two compliance reviews remain outstanding, and the franchisee has requested extended payment terms. Background on our negotiating position is appended below.

management briefing: Project Ulavan slips by two quarters because of the staffing delay.

### Step 4: Point Flagline at the new evaluator

Once the Flagline SDK in your service is upgraded to v2, rollout rules are evaluated locally instead of via the control plane. Restart the service after the config change so the evaluator picks up its rule cache settings. The values the evaluator expects at startup are the following.

deployment values, bagag-bawig:
DRUVAN_PIN=0740
DRUVAN_TENANT=wendor
DRUVAN_METRICS_HOST=metrics.druvan.tolvaqnet.example
DRUVAN_SEAL=seal_75cd0b2d
DRUVAN_STANDBY_TEAM=tamael

// Tide-table widget for the Gullwharf harbor app.
//
// Heads up, future maintainer: the tide predictions come from the
// Pelorus feed, which updates on its own schedule, so we cache
// aggressively and interpolate between samples. The interpolation
// window and refresh cadence were hand-tuned after the widget kept
// showing stale lows during spring tides. Don't shrink the cache TTL
// without checking the feed's rate cap, or we'll get throttled again.
// The tuned constants live just below this comment.

limits module of kahap-baguf:
QUOTAS = {
    "lamius": 873,
    "holiel": 809,
    "silmir": 252,
    "kaswyn": 562,
    "jorox": 1004,
}

TURN-208: Gatevale turnstile counters at the Merrow Field pilot double-count when a rotation reverses mid-cycle. Attendance totals drift roughly 2% high per event. The debounce window fix is implemented, reviewed by Ilsa, and soak-tested across two simulated match days without drift. Ready for your cut; the candidate build is identified below.

trace token, tagag-tafog: htk6_5ed18c